Transaction 32770e2ad0615a4303761a9f9fe557ac71b91f8f1451baf6a88a35dad9361f3a
1 Input
1 Output
-
32770e2ad0615a4303761a9f9fe557ac71b91f8f1451baf6a88a35dad9361f3a:0
- value
- 838000
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fe7102cccf5c034a104c08b111b4fea127a03f7
- address
- bc1q3ln3qtxv7hqrfggycz93zx60agf85qlhhl07s8